Alert system

ECM00091
NOTICE
Do not continue to operate the engine if a
alert device has activated. Consult your
Yamaha dealer if the problem cannot be lo-
cated and corrected.

Overheat alert

The outboard motor is equipped with an over-
heat alert system. If the engine temperature
rises too high, the alert system will activate.
The engine speed will automatically de-
G
crease to about 2000 r/min.
The overheat-alert indicator will come on or
G
blink.
1
1. Overheat-alert indicator
The buzzer will sound.
G

Engine control system

If the alert system has activated, stop the en-
gine and check the cooling water inlet.
Check the trim angle to check that the cool-
G
ing water inlet is submerged.
Check the cooling water inlet for clogging.
G

Low oil pressure alert

The outboard motor is equipped with a low oil
pressure alert system. If the engine oil pres-
sure is low, the alert system will activate.
The engine speed will automatically de-
G
crease to about 2000 r/min.
The low oil pressure-alert indicator will
G
come on or blink.
ZMU07010
1
1. Low oil pressure-alert indicator
The buzzer will sound.
